SEQUENT MICROSYSTEMS Raspberry Pi 用スマート ファン HAT

概要

スマートファンは、Raspberry Pi 用の最もエレガントでコンパクト、そして安価な冷却ソリューションです。Raspberry Pi HAT のフォームファクタを備えています。I2C インターフェイスを介して Raspberry Pi からコマンドを受信します。昇圧電源は、Raspberry Pi から供給される 5 ボルトを 12 ボルトに変換し、正確な速度制御を保証します。パルス幅変調を使用して、Raspberry Pi プロセッサの温度を一定に保つのに十分な電力をファンに供給します。
スマートファンはすべての GPIO ピンを保持するため、Raspberry Pi の上に任意の数のカードを積み重ねることができます。別のアドオンカードで電力を消費する必要がある場合は、2 番目のスマートファンをスタックに追加できます。
特徴
- 40x40x10mmファン、6CFMのエアフロー
- 正確なファン速度制御のためのステップアップ12V電源
- PWMコントローラはファンを調整してPiの温度を一定に保ちます
- 消費電流は100mA未満
- 完全にスタック可能なので、Raspberry Piに他のカードを追加できます。
- I2Cインターフェースのみを使用し、すべてのGPIOピンをフル活用
- 非常に静かで効率的
- すべての取り付けハードウェアが含まれています:真鍮スタンドオフ、ネジ、ナット
- コマンドライン、Node-RED、Python ドライバー
キットの内容
- Raspberry Pi 用スマートファンアドオンカード

- 40x40x10mmファン(取り付けネジ付き)

- 取り付け金具

a. M2.5x19mm オス-メス真鍮製スタンドオフ XNUMX 個
b. M2.5x5mm 真鍮ネジ XNUMX 本
c. M2.5真鍮ナットXNUMX個
クイック スタートアップ ガイド
- スマートファンカードをRaspberry Piの上に差し込み、システムの電源を入れます。
- raspi-config を使用して、Raspberry Pi で I2C 通信を有効にします。
- 3. Smart Fanソフトウェアをインストールする github.com:
~$ git クローン https://github.com/SequentMicrosystems/SmartFan-rpi.git
~$ cd /home/pi/SmartFan-rpi
~/SmartFan-rpi$ sudo インストール
~/SmartFan-rpi$ ファン
プログラムは、使用可能なコマンドのリストで応答します。
ボードレイアウト

スマートファンには適切な取り付けハードウェアが付属しています。すべての表面実装コンポーネントは底面に取り付けられています。ファンは Raspberry Pi GPIO コネクタから電源供給され、消費電流は 100mA 未満です。各 Raspberry Pi には 4 つまたは XNUMX つのファンを取り付けることができます。XNUMX つ目のファンがある場合は、コネクタ JXNUMX にジャンパーを取り付ける必要があります。
ブロック図

電力要件
スマートファンは、Raspberry Pi GPIO コネクタから電源を供給されます。100V で 5mA 未満の電流を消費します。ファンは、正確な速度制御を可能にするオンボードの 12V ステップアップ電源によって電源供給されます。
機械仕様

Smart Fan は Raspberry Pi HAT と同じフォーム ファクターを備えています。
ソフトウェアのセットアップ
ウォッチドッグ ボードは I2C アドレス 0x30 を占有します。
- Raspberry Piを準備し、 最新のOS。
- I2C 通信を有効にします。
~$ sudo raspi-config
- ユーザーパスワードの変更 デフォルトユーザーのパスワードを変更します
- ネットワーク オプション ネットワーク設定を構成する
- 起動オプション 起動時のオプションを構成します
- ローカリゼーション オプション 言語と地域設定を一致するように設定します。
- インターフェースオプション 周辺機器への接続を構成する
- オーバークロック Pi のオーバークロックを構成する
- 詳細オプション 詳細設定を構成する
- 更新 このツールを最新バージョンに更新します
- raspi-config について この構成に関する情報
P1 カメラ Raspberry Pi カメラへの接続を有効/無効にする
P2 パスワード Piへのリモートコマンドラインアクセスを有効/無効にする
P3 VC Pi へのグラフィカル リモート アクセスを有効/無効にします…
P4 SPI SPIカーネルモジュールの自動読み込みを有効/無効にする
P5 I2C I2Cカーネルモジュールの自動読み込みを有効/無効にする
P6 シリアル シリアルポートへのシェルおよびカーネルメッセージの有効化/無効化
P7 1 線式 ワンワイヤインターフェースの有効化/無効化
P8 リモートGPIO GPIOピンへのリモートアクセスを有効/無効にする
3. Smart Fanソフトウェアをインストールする github.com:
~$ git クローン https://github.com/SequentMicrosystems/SmartFan-rpi.git
~$ cd /home/pi/SmartFan-rpi
~/wdt-rpi$ sudo インストール
~/wdt-rpi$ ファン
プログラムは利用可能なコマンドのリストを返します。オンライン ヘルプを表示するには、「fan -h」と入力してください。
ソフトウェアをインストールしたら、次のコマンドを使用して最新バージョンに更新できます。
~$ cd /home/pi/SmartFan
~/wdt-rpi$ git プル
~/wdt-rpi$ sudo インストール
ソフトウェアをインストールしたら、コマンド「fan」でスマートファンにアクセスできます。スマートファンは、使用可能なコマンドのリストで応答します。
スマートファンソフトウェア
スマートファンは、シンプルなコマンド ライン Python 関数を使用して、任意のプログラムから制御できます。
Node-Redインターフェースを使用すると、ブラウザから温度を設定および監視できます。ソフトウェアはログに温度履歴を保持できます。 file Excelでプロットできる例ample loopは以下にあります GitHub.com
https://github.com/SequentMicrosystems/SmartFan-rpi/tree/main/python/examples
ファン速度の制御
スマートファンはI2Cインターフェースのスレーブなので、Raspberry Piは何をすべきかを指示する必要があります。ファン速度を制御するには、コマンドラインとPython関数を使用できます。Raspberry Piはプロセッサの温度を監視し、それに応じてファン速度を制御する必要があります。PIDループはampプログラムは GitHub からダウンロードできます。故障の場合、温度が安全限度を超えると、Raspberry Pi は焼損を防ぐために自動的にシャットダウンする必要があります。
セルフテスト
スマート ファンには、ローカル プロセッサによって制御される LED があります。電源投入時にプロセッサがファンを 1 秒間起動するため、ユーザーはシステムが機能していることを確認できます。オンボード LED はファンの状態を示します。ファンがオフの場合、LED は 1 秒あたり 2 回点滅します。ファンがオンの場合、LED はファンの速度に比例して 10 秒あたり XNUMX ~ XNUMX 回点滅します。
ドキュメント / リソース
![]() |
SEQUENT MICROSYSTEMS Raspberry Pi 用スマート ファン HAT [pdf] ユーザーガイド Raspberry Pi用スマートファンHAT、Raspberry Pi用ファンHAT、Raspberry Pi、Pi |




